Board repair today, and the most text-book example of an Apple Board Repair job I've seen in a long time. Spoilers down below...
Short-circuit on PPBUS_G3H, used voltage injection to discover a shorted cap on input to DDR3-core supply. Replaced cap.

Tantalum capacitors are prone to short circuit faults caused by age and driving them with too much ripple too close to their voltage spec. I would suggest fitting new ones every time. The heat of fitting the 2nd hand replacement just pushes it closer to the end of it's life as well. Nice repair though......

A high reading on a capacitor read from a DMM can also mean leakage. Remember DMM's measure capacitance using charge timing. You can increase charge timing by adding leakage.

You are not wrong that if a capacitor is measuring a tad over, it's no big deal. I believe it is important to stress the point, that it's ok if it's over as long as it is inside of the given tolerance. This is important because a leaking capacitor will show "over" capacity, which is to say, it's going to fail soon. Best to replace with a new one IMO.
